A beautiful example of a highly desirable three bedroom semi detached home in this popular and sought-after location. Falling close to Stourbridge Junction, Stevens Park and nearby Wychbury fields, the property briefly comprises of entrance porch and hall, dining room with double doors leading to lounge with feature fire place. Fitted kitchen/breakfast room complete with breakfast bar, utility room and downstairs cloakroom and integral garage completing the ground floor. Continuing upstairs are three good sized double bedrooms and family bathroom. The rear garden is thoughtfully laid out with various private seating areas, well maintained lawn and patio area. Additional benefits include a good-size driveway and is located close to reputable schools and shops for convenience.

Agents are required by law to conduct anti-money laundering checks on all those buying a property. We outsource the initial checks to a partner supplier Coadjute who will contact you once you have had an offer accepted on a property you wish to buy. The cost of these checks is £45+VAT per buyer and this is a non-refundable fee. These charges cover the cost of obtaining relevant data, any manual checks and monitoring which might be required. This fee will need to be paid and the checks completed in advance of the office issuing a memorandum of sale on the property you would like to buy.
